The book "The Study of Rhythms and Technology" by Paul Schatz offers a fascinating exploration of the connection between art, design, and the natural sciences. Schatz, a talented wood sculptor and technician, presents his innovative ideas for harmonizing the laws and rhythms of nature with technological developments. By examining forms such as oloids and cuboids, the work opens new perspectives on geometric and architectural spaces. It highlights the application of these forms in various fields, including industrial use and environmental engineering. With 156 pages, the book not only provides a comprehensive representation of Schatz's life's work but also inspires philosophers and practitioners working at the intersection of art and science. The combination of theoretical concepts and practical applications makes this book a valuable resource for anyone interested in the interactions between rhythm and technology.
